Beitrag: The Means To Develop A Drone Control Application?

The Means To Develop A Drone Control Application?

Once the goal market and consumer necessities are established, the event staff focuses on making a user-friendly interface with a seamless and intuitive design. This is essential as drones can be complicated units to function, and it’s essential for users to have easy access to all the necessary controls. UAV Forecast, known for its accuracy and reliability, is a highly sought-after drone management software amongst drone enthusiasts and professionals alike. Apart from delivering essential Digital Logistics Solutions weather updates like wind velocity, direction, precipitation, and temperature, it presents detailed visibility knowledge to boost flight planning.

Overview Of A Sample Drone Software Architecture

This latest stable model offers improved ROS 2 and uXRCE-DDS integration, expanded hardware assist, and enhanced navigation capabilities. Not to say the new Throw Mode, improved state estimation, up to date Gazebo simulation, and optical move help. Don’t miss out on all the improvements – Thanks to everybody drone software development who contributed to creating this occur,from committers, to community supporters who helped create content material, documentation, and flight testing. Optelos is a drone administration software program designed for drone pilots and companies. Non-functional necessities (NFRs) explain how software program capabilities when it comes to high quality and system properties, not specific options. Despite being erroneously perceived as less crucial than practical requirements, NFRs considerably influence solution improvement and testing.

Eufy Troubleshooting Guide: Solutions For Frequent Device Issues

Drone Software Development

The digital camera display permits users to change digital camera settings, overview the parameters like battery degree, GPS signal, photograph & video options, gimbal distance to the “Home” tag on the map, and so forth. Several flying modes that change drones’ maximum pace or how delicate it is to the controllers may also be changed through this display. As applied sciences evolve and new developments in drone programming emerge, keep updated with the latest trends and techniques. Embrace the opportunity to be taught and adapt, and don’t draw back from exploring innovative approaches to realize the desired drone behaviors. Before diving into drone programming, it’s essential to have a strong understanding of the essential concepts and components that make up a drone. This information will present a strong foundation in your programming endeavors and allow you to make sense of the code and commands you’ll be working with.

How To Program Drone Flight Path

  • This lets you run your app on Android and iOS with one codebase.
  • At the guts of this transformation are Drone Software Development Kits (SDKs), important frameworks that empower builders to unlock the total potential of drone expertise.
  • Imagine a metropolis where site visitors navigates seamlessly, security is always prioritized, and environmental sustainability is actively monitored.
  • Embark on a transformative journey with IdeaUsher, your trusted associate in Drone Software Development.

As the drone market continues to increase,  the demand for skilled cell app developers in this subject is on the rise. Leverage our all-round software program improvement companies – from consulting to support and evolution. Additionally, physical safety features of drone apps, similar to obstacle avoidance and emergency touchdown capabilities, can help you keep away from hazard.

Outsourcing a group of professional app developers can cost anywhere from $50 to $250 per hour for his or her providers. Additionally, if you want to develop a custom drone app, you’ll need to invest in the hardware and software program required to build and take a look at the app, which may be costly. Once you finally determine to proceed with drone app design and growth, the entire estimation to develop it have to be your concern. This part will allow you to set your budget to construct a Drone control application. AR Drone 2.zero SDK is free, flexible, and easy to use and has a full vary of options and performance, allowing developers to regulate the company’s AR Drone 2.0 quadcopter. It is available for iOS and Android and permits QA to test the applying with a simulated drone in a virtual surroundings.

As for the Profiles Screen, it’s a suitable place to implement gamification options. You can add customizable profile avatars, achievements (like “Fly 3 km in 1 week ✈️”), in-app coins, pal referring, Social Media integration, etc. Selecting the appropriate Drone SDK is a critical choice that can considerably impact the effectiveness and success of your drone tasks. Looking forward, builders must give attention to sustainability, ethical use, and continuous innovation to maintain pace with technological advancements and societal wants. Developing SDKs that supply consistent performance and reliability, particularly in various environmental situations, is crucial. Drones should operate safely and effectively under totally different scenarios.

Drone Software Development

Affordability lowers the expectations of customers, nonetheless, it’s still necessary to offer a functional application that greatly works with the drones and doesn’t have efficiency troubles. So, let’s check out what Tello App presents and if it meets such skills. They have a physical controller that will get related to users’ mobiles devices or tablets via a USB cable. The app includes a map where users see their present areas and tips about discovering runways for drones. You can even verify zones which are restricted from flying or these the place you require authorization.

B4UFLY, a popular drone management software, was created by the Federal Aviation Administration (FAA) in partnership with Kittyhawk. This app is extensively utilized by drone lovers because it provides up-to-the-minute particulars on airspace restrictions, current climate situations, and the proximity of airports. By providing complete information, customers could make informed decisions relating to the security and legality of flying their drones in specific locations. Drone SDKs have evolved considerably, paralleling the developments in drone expertise. Initially, these kits were fundamental, providing restricted control and functionality. However, as drones have become extra subtle, so have the SDKs, now offering advanced features corresponding to real-time information streaming, autonomous flight control, and more.

FlytBase is a popular SDK and API option for drone software program development. It supplies builders with access to various tools and assets similar to APIs, SDKs, and developer documentation. Furthermore, drone control apps additionally bear rigorous testing to make sure their reliability and security. This involves simulating numerous flight scenarios and figuring out any potential points or bugs that need to be fastened earlier than the app is launched to the general public.

This easy-to-use smartphone app allows drone operators to learn about restrictions and location-specific requirements in their specific region. This makes flights safer and more efficient, even in difficult environments. Machine studying models can analyze this data to find helpful insights for different industries. Generally, it’s an excellent app with all needed capabilities for drone management, taking Tello drones’ affordability into consideration.

We are your reliable associate in innovation, delivering cutting-edge solutions that drive progress and propel your small business forward. Our commitment to quality, cost-efficiency, comprehensive service, and ongoing support units us apart from the rest. Furthermore, DJI’s SDK and API are continually updated with new options, ensuring that developers have entry to the newest expertise for his or her drone tasks. Additionally, DJI has a large community of builders who share their knowledge and experiences, offering priceless support and sources for newcomers to the platform. DJI, a frontrunner in the drone trade, presents an SDK that is renowned for its comprehensive features, supporting a extensive range of functions from aerial photography to industrial inspections.

Drone Software Development

They help customers to plan and conduct flights, as well as display information from a drone to users. User software additionally consists of interfaces for communication with the cloud and the drone. Finally, the placement of the development team also can impression the price of making a drone app. The cost of hiring providers from Western nations like the United States or the United Kingdom may be barely higher than countries like India or Eastern Europe. By combining the right set of instruments, your drone management app can ship instructions and receive information similar to flight standing, GPS location, and sensor indications. Hence, if you need to create an app that is distinctive, developing a drone control app is a strong business move.

However, developing a practical and user-friendly app could be difficult and requires experience in software program development and knowledge of drone technology. It is recommended to consult with experienced professionals or companies specializing in drone software program development for one of the best outcomes. Developing software program for drones often requires a collaborative effort involving varied individuals with numerous talent sets. A typical drone development project involves hardware engineers, software developers, consumer expertise designers, and testers working closely together to create a cohesive finish product. Utilizing project management instruments and methodologies such as Agile or Scrum may help streamline the development process and guarantee effective communication amongst staff members. It is crucial to ascertain clear roles and obligations, set realistic timelines, and regularly evaluation progress as a group to deliver a successful drone software project.

Agile methodology is really helpful for environment friendly drone software program development. DroneKit is another greatest platform for creating drone management  software, and the SDK is out there for creating apps on the Android platform. The SDK and API supplied by DroneKit are free, and the API is simple to use and could be prolonged to help extra sensors and actuators.

Software performs an enormous position here, where it processes data from varied sources to handle control and flight dynamics. In the world of drone expertise, understanding tips on how to program a drone opens up an enormous array of possibilities. Let’s look at the core features of drone programming, from the languages used to the mixing of software with drone hardware. Some well-liked online choices include Drone Pilot Ground School and UAV Coach.

Transform Your Business With AI Software Development Solutions https://www.globalcloudteam.com/ — be successful, be the first!